  A LOW TRICK

The meanest trick I ever knewWas one I know you never do.I saw a Goop once try to do it,And there was nothing funny to it.He pulled a chair from under meAs I was sitting down; but heWas sent to bed, and rightly, too.It was a horrid thing to do!

 
 
  WHEN TO GO

When you go a-calling,

Never stay too late;

You will wear your welcome out

If you hesitate!

Just before they're tired of you,

Just before they yawn,

Before they think you are a Goop,

And wish that you were gone,

While they're laughing with you,

While they like you so,

While they want to keep you,—

That's the time to go!

 
 
"AIN'T"

Now "ain't" is a word

That is very absurd

To use for an "isn't" or "aren't."

Ask Teacher about it:

She'll say, "Do without it!"

I wish you would see if you can't!


 
NELL THE NIBBLER

 

She ate some chocolate drops at 1,

At 2, she thought she'd take

A little jelly and a bun;

At 3, some frosted cake.

 

At 4, she nibbled at a roll;

At 5, a doughnut spied,

And ate it (all except the hole),

And then some cookies tried.

 

At 6, she didn't feel quite right,

And didn't care for dinner.

She said she had no appetite,

With so much Goop-food in her!


 
  JUSTICE

Whenever brother's sent to bed,

Or punished, do not go

And peer at him and jeer at him,

And say, "I told you so!"

 

 

Nor should you try to make him laugh

When he has been so bad;

Let him confess his naughtiness

Before you both are glad!

 

 
 
A PUZZLE

There are about a thousand things

I'm not allowed to do;

Most everything I'm fondest of

I'm told is wrong—are you?

 

They say, "Please don't do that, my child!"

They say, "You mustn't, dear!"

I hope sometime I'll learn what's right,

For now it seems so queer!


 
FRANKNESS

When you are talking, I expectYou'd better hold your head erect!Please look me squarely in the eyeUnless you're telling me a lie.For if you crouch and look askance,Regarding me with sidelong glance,I'll think it is a Goop I seeWho is afraid to look at me!
